Transaction 61eacb613fd2c9433a95a2812769897875870cca1d9c5cdd5dd40a5be4f80714

block
80101171b5dd9b18a19a1e0006fab18addd0c28607c79e72930494ed9d507ffd

14 Inputs

1 Output